Son of Hamas’ Mosab Hassan Yousef: ‘If We Finish Rafah, We Finish Hamas’

Natan Galula
Times of Israel, Apr. 24, 2024
 
“I made a decision to burn this evil down to ashes.”
 
One of the most passionate voices in support of a large-scale Israel Defense Force operation to clear Hamas from its last major stronghold in the Gaza Strip’s southernmost city of Rafah comes from a man raised by the terrorist organization.

Mosab Hassan Yousef, the disowned son of a Hamas co-founder Sheikh Hassan Yousef, told The Times of Israel last week that the Israeli government must “finish the job” in Gaza to remove Hamas from power, regardless of the unfolding situation with Iran.

“We need to go into Rafah now. Not tomorrow. What are we waiting for? We finish Rafah, we finish Hamas. This will remove them from power, which will be the first step [toward peace],” he said.

The 45-year-old was born in Ramallah and vividly remembers the foundation of Hamas in 1986. Decades ago, Yousef was dubbed the “Green Prince” (also the title of a 2014 documentary based on his autobiography) for his efforts to help Israel’s internal security agency, the Shin Bet, in thwarting terror attacks during the Second Intifada in the early 2000s.
